Prumnopitys andina

Common Names

Plum-fruited yew (2).

Taxonomic notes

Syn: Prumnopitys elegans Philippi, Podocarpus andinus Poeppig (1, 2).

Description

Tree to 25 m. Leaves linear with glaucous strip on either side of the midrib on abaxial surface. The seeds are fleshy like olives (2).

Range

S Chile (1).
